A3.5.6 Inspection items for pressure gauges (1) Whether the selection of pressure gauges meets the requirements; (2) Pressure gauge regular inspection and maintenance system: whether the calibration validity period and seals meet the requirements ; (3) Do the appearance, accuracy class, range, and dial diameter of the pressure gauge meet the requirements? ; (4) Whether the location of the three-way stopcock or needle valve installed between the pressure gauge and the pipeline, its opening indication, and its locking device meet the requirements ; (5) Whether the readings of the pressure gauges on the same system are reasonable. During inspections, issues such as incorrect selection of pressure gauges, broken glass on the gauge face, unclear markings on the dial, damaged seals, expiration of the calibration period, leaks in the Bourdon tube, loose or distorted pointers, severe corrosion of the casing, unclear indication marks on the three-way valves or needle valves, and damaged locking mechanisms were found. The using unit must take effective measures to ensure the safe operation of the pipeline; otherwise, its operation must be suspended.
